Description

A kind of machining coolant
Technical field
The present invention relates to a kind of machining coolants, belong to coolant technical field.
Background technology
Lathe into driving, milling, boring, the process bored, if processing for a long time, certainly will cause tool temperature anxious workpiece Play rises, and so as to influence tool sharpening performance, accelerates the rate of wear of cutter.People have developed corresponding coolant and use thus In solving the above problems, it is mainly used for solving cooling, lubrication, cleaning and the several purposes of antirust during coolant use.But Be existing coolant can not well by it is several effect combine so that existing coolant be constantly present it is each The deficiency of aspect performance.
Invention content
The object of the present invention is to provide a kind of machining coolants.The coolant can be well by several aspects Effect combine, coolant is avoided to deposit deficiency in some respect.
Technical scheme of the present invention: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:20-50 parts of wheat grass juice factor, 20-50 parts of vegetable oil, 3-8 parts of N- (phosphonomethyl) glycines, 5-10 parts of potassium hydroxide, benzene first Sour sodium 5-10 parts, 3-8 parts of butylhydroquinone, 15-25 parts of methyl orthosilicate, 8-15 parts of organic silicone oil, 0-20 parts of phosphatase 11, nitre Sour sodium 10-20 parts, 15-25 parts of triethanolamine, 1-3 parts of fluoboric acid, 5-10 parts of sodium chloride.
Aforementioned machining coolant, the coolant with following composition by weight than raw material be made:Wheat grass juice factor 30-40 Part, 30-40 parts of vegetable oil, 5-7 parts of N- (phosphonomethyl) glycines, 7-9 parts of potassium hydroxide, 7-9 parts of sodium benzoate, butyl pair 5-7 parts of benzenediol, 18-22 parts of methyl orthosilicate, 10-13 parts of organic silicone oil, 3-17 parts of phosphatase 11,13-17 parts of sodium nitrate, three second 18-22 parts of hydramine, 1-3 parts of fluoboric acid, 7-9 parts of sodium chloride.
Aforementioned machining coolant, the coolant with following composition by weight than raw material be made:35 parts of wheat grass juice factor, 35 parts of vegetable oil, 6 parts of N- (phosphonomethyl) glycines, 8 parts of potassium hydroxide, 8 parts of sodium benzoate, 6 parts of butylhydroquinone, just 20 parts of methyl silicate, 12 parts of organic silicone oil, 5 parts of phosphatase 11,15 parts of sodium nitrate, 20 parts of triethanolamine, 2 parts of fluoboric acid, sodium chloride 8 Part.
Beneficial effects of the present invention:Compared with prior art, coolant of the invention in cooling, lubrication, cleaning and is prevented Preferable effect is respectively provided with, and in the coolant and do not contain harmful substance in terms of rust, which can continuously recycle 8 A month without going bad, it is smelly, and corrosion will not be generated to workpiece and lathe, it is raw materials used to be without penetrating odor The relatively conventional product in market, it is convenient to prepare, and cost is relatively low.
Specific embodiment
With reference to embodiment, the present invention is further illustrated, but is not intended as the foundation limited the present invention.
The embodiment of the present invention 1: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:Wheat grass juice factor 20kg, vegetable oil 50kg, N- (phosphonomethyl) glycine 3kg, potassium hydroxide 10kg, sodium benzoate 5kg, fourth Base hydroquinone 8kg, methyl orthosilicate 15kg, organic silicone oil 15kg, phosphatase 11 0kg, sodium nitrate 20kg, triethanolamine 15kg, fluorine Boric acid 3kg, sodium chloride 5kg.
The embodiment of the present invention 2: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:Wheat grass juice factor 50kg, vegetable oil 20kg, N- (phosphonomethyl) glycine 8kg, potassium hydroxide 5kg, sodium benzoate 10kg, fourth Base hydroquinone 3kg, methyl orthosilicate 25kg, organic silicone oil 8kg, phosphoric acid 20kg, sodium nitrate 10kg, triethanolamine 25kg, fluorine Boric acid 1kg, sodium chloride 10kg.
The embodiment of the present invention 3: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:Wheat grass juice factor 30kg, vegetable oil 40kg, N- (phosphonomethyl) glycine 5kg, potassium hydroxide 9kg, sodium benzoate 7kg, fourth Base hydroquinone 7kg, methyl orthosilicate 18kg, organic silicone oil 13kg, phosphatase 11 3kg, sodium nitrate 17kg, triethanolamine 18kg, Fluoboric acid 3kg, sodium chloride 7kg.
The embodiment of the present invention 4: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:Wheat grass juice factor 40kg, vegetable oil 30kg, N- (phosphonomethyl) glycine 7kg, potassium hydroxide 7kg, sodium benzoate 9kg, fourth Base hydroquinone 5kg, methyl orthosilicate 22kg, organic silicone oil 10kg, phosphatase 11 7kg, sodium nitrate 13kg, triethanolamine 22kg, Fluoboric acid 1kg, sodium chloride 9kg.
The embodiment of the present invention 5:A kind of machining coolant, the coolant with following composition by weight than raw material system Into:Wheat grass juice factor 35kg, vegetable oil 35kg, N- (phosphonomethyl) glycine 6kg, potassium hydroxide 8kg, sodium benzoate 8kg, fourth Base hydroquinone 6kg, methyl orthosilicate 20kg, organic silicone oil 12kg, phosphatase 11 5kg, sodium nitrate 15kg, triethanolamine 20kg, Fluoboric acid 2kg, sodium chloride 8kg.
When prepared by the coolant of above example, various raw materials are put into container and are stirred evenly.
